docker-compose-kafka2-cluster2.yml version:'3.3'services:zoo1:image:zookeeper:3.6.1hostname:zoo1ports:-"2181:2181"volumes:-/etc/localtime:/etc/localtime:ro-zookeeper1_data:/data-zookeeper1_datalog:/datalogenvironment:ZOO_MY_ID:1ZOO_SERVERS:server.1=zoo1:2888:3888;2181server.2=zoo2:2888:...
- KAFKA_KRAFT_CLUSTER_ID=abcdefghijklmnopqrstuv - KAFKA_CFG_LISTENERS=PLAINTEXT://:9092,CONTROLLER://:9093,EXTERNAL://:9095 - KAFKA_CFG_ADVERTISED_LISTENERS=PLAINTEXT://kafka-1:9092,EXTERNAL://172.25.114.2:9095 - KAFKA_CFG_LISTENER_SECURITY_PROTOCOL_MAP=CONTROLLER:PLAINTEXT,EXTERNAL:PLAINTEXT,PLA...
Swarm 集群( Cluster )为 组被统一管理起来的 Docker 主机 集群是 Swarm 所管理的对象 这些主机通过 Docker 引擎的 Swarm 模式相互沟通,其中部分主机可能作为管理节点(manager )响应外部的管理请求,其他主机作为工作节点( worker )来实际运行 Docker 容器。当然,同一个主机也可以即作为管理节点,同时作为工作节点。 当...
kafka安装包用的是2.9.2-0.8.1版本,在git@github.com:zq2599/docker_kafka.git中,请clone获取; 启动kafka server的shell脚本内容如下,很简单,在kafka的bin目录下执行脚本启动server即可: #!/bin/bash $WORK_PATH/$KAFKA_PACKAGE_NAME/bin/kafka-server-start.sh $WORK_PATH/$KAFKA_PACKAGE_NAME/config/server...
防火墙开启 按需开启9093、9092、2181等端口 Kafka服务配置 登录Kafka Map ,用户名密码为admin/admin import cluster 添加新建kafka集群 管理kafka 集群 参考链接
接zookeeper 部分 添加 kafka功能 , #docker-compose.yaml version:'3'services:zoo1:image:zookeeper:3.6.1restart:always hostname:zoo1 ports:-2181:2181volumes:-/etc/localtime:/etc/localtime:ro-/home/zk/zookeeper1/data:/data-/home/zk/zookeeper1/datalog:/datalog ...
很多的现代化可扩展性的数据处理应用都可以在 Mesos 上运行,包括大数据框架 Hadoop、Kafka、Spark。 但是大而全,往往就是对应的复杂和困难,这一点体现在 Messos 上是完全正确,与Docker 和 Docker Swarm 使用同一种 API 不同的,Mesos 和 Marathon 都有自己的 API,这使得它们比其他编排系统更加的复杂。Apache ...
部署kubernetes master cluster,分别部署有 kube-apiserver,kube-scheduler,kube-controller-manager; 增加对kubernetes访问的 认证 & 授权, 具体可参考我之前的blog,kubernetes Authorization, kubernetes Authentication , kubernetes中的Admission Controllers 关闭kube master的非安全端口访问,关闭 insecure-port,开启secure-port...
docker-compose scale kafka=3 Destroy a cluster: docker-compose stop Note The defaultdocker-compose.ymlshould be seen as a starting point. By default each broker will get a new port number and broker id on restart. Depending on your use case this might not be desirable. If you need to us...
Docker Swarm Nodes Dashboard URL:http://<swarm-ip>:3000/dashboard/db/docker-swarm-nodes This dashboard shows key metrics for monitoring the resource usage of your Swarm nodes and can be filtered by node ID: Cluster up-time, number of nodes, number of CPUs, CPU idle gauge ...